How to import trades from TradeStation to TradesViz trading journal?
To import your file, please visit https://tradesviz.com/import by selecting the import button at the bottom left corner of your dashboard or by clicking on your profile icon at the top right corner and selecting "Import/Export". Next, select your trading account in the first dropdown and then the platform as TradeStation in the second dropdown.
TradeStation Import Instructions
Currently Supported:
- Stocks
- Options
- Futures
Note: You can automatically sync your trades by connecting directly with TradeStation! Learn more: https://tradesviz.com/blog/auto-import-tradestation/
- Navigate to TradeManager in your TradeStation application.
- Select the "Orders" tab on the bottom of the screen.
- From the "Status" drop-down at the top of the same screen, select "Filled Orders".
- Now select the date range according to your preferences and click on the "Retrieve Orders" button.
- Copy all the content by pressing Ctrl+A and then Ctrl+C (Note: Please make sure the column headers are also selected!)
- Paste (Ctrl+V) the copied content into the empty text area below and then click "Upload" at the bottom of the page.
Note:
If you have a lot of spread trades in your account, the prices will not be correctly imported. Use the alternative import method given below.
But the format below does not have HH:MM:SS data! TradesViz fills it in as 09:30 as default.
